What is Borosilicate Glass?

So, what is borosilicate glass, and why is it so popular among consumers? Borosilicate glass is a type of glass that contains boron and silicon dioxide. This unique combination of materials gives borosilicate glass its characteristic properties, including:

  • Thermal shock resistance: Borosilicate glass can withstand extreme temperature changes without breaking or shattering.
  • Chemical resistance: Borosilicate glass is resistant to acidic and alkaline substances, making it perfect for storing and serving food and drinks.
  • Clarity and transparency: Borosilicate glass is known for its exceptional clarity and transparency, making it ideal for laboratory equipment and cookware.

Borosilicate glass is often used in laboratory equipment, cookware, and bakeware due to its unique properties. Brands like Pyrex and Borcam have popularized borosilicate glassware, and many consumers swear by its durability and performance.

What Type of Glass Does Anchor Hocking Use?

So, is Anchor Hocking made of borosilicate glass? The answer is no. Anchor Hocking uses a type of glass called soda-lime glass, which is the most common type of glass used in the manufacturing of glassware.

Soda-lime glass is made from a combination of silicon dioxide, sodium oxide, and calcium oxide. While it is not as heat-resistant as borosilicate glass, soda-lime glass is still a high-quality material that is perfect for many applications.

Anchor Hocking’s soda-lime glass is known for its:

  • Affordability: Soda-lime glass is generally less expensive to produce than borosilicate glass, making it a more affordable option for consumers.
  • Durability: Soda-lime glass is still a durable material that can withstand normal use and handling.
  • Clarity and transparency: Anchor Hocking’s soda-lime glass is known for its exceptional clarity and transparency, making it perfect for storing and serving food and drinks.

Benefits and Drawbacks of Soda-Lime Glass

While soda-lime glass is a high-quality material, it does have some drawbacks compared to borosilicate glass. Here are some of the benefits and drawbacks of soda-lime glass:

Benefits:

  • Affordability: Soda-lime glass is generally less expensive to produce than borosilicate glass.
  • Wide availability: Soda-lime glass is widely available and can be found in many different products, from glassware to windows.
  • Easy to manufacture: Soda-lime glass is relatively easy to manufacture, making it a popular choice for many applications.

Drawbacks:

  • Thermal shock resistance: Soda-lime glass is not as heat-resistant as borosilicate glass and can break or shatter if exposed to extreme temperature changes.
  • Chemical resistance: Soda-lime glass is not as resistant to acidic and alkaline substances as borosilicate glass.
  • Durability: While soda-lime glass is durable, it is not as durable as borosilicate glass and can be prone to scratches and chips.

What is Borosilicate Glass, and How is it Different from Other Types of Glass?

Borosilicate glass is a type of glass that is made from a mixture of silicon dioxide, boron, and sodium oxide. It is known for its unique properties, which include its ability to withstand extreme temperatures, its resistance to thermal shock, and its non-reactive surface. Borosilicate glass is often used to make laboratory equipment, cookware, and other types of glassware that require high heat resistance and durability.

One of the key differences between borosilicate glass and other types of glass is its coefficient of thermal expansion. This refers to the rate at which the glass expands and contracts when it is heated or cooled. Borosilicate glass has a very low coefficient of thermal expansion, which means that it is less likely to break or shatter when it is exposed to extreme temperatures. This makes it an ideal material for applications where heat resistance is critical.

What are the Benefits of Using Borosilicate Glass?

Borosilicate glass has a number of benefits that make it a popular choice for many applications. One of the main benefits is its heat resistance, which makes it ideal for use in cookware, laboratory equipment, and other types of glassware that are exposed to high temperatures. Borosilicate glass is also non-reactive, which means that it won’t leach chemicals into food or other substances that it comes into contact with.

Another benefit of borosilicate glass is its durability. It is highly resistant to thermal shock, which means that it can withstand extreme temperature changes without breaking or shattering. This makes it a great choice for applications where the glass may be exposed to sudden or extreme temperature changes. Additionally, borosilicate glass is easy to clean and maintain, and it can be sterilized in an autoclave or by washing it in hot soapy water.
